Output 983887018224c4e0c74638b123c37b8e1f2b798eafc427c4dc51643ff6b5d7d5:0

value
105381623
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 87589a788d07b28a3ecdcbccac265b97be52b02a OP_EQUALVERIFY OP_CHECKSIG
address
1DLeNApsHNNzUMNZJVoXeyEY5sdp8vzx3w
transaction
983887018224c4e0c74638b123c37b8e1f2b798eafc427c4dc51643ff6b5d7d5
confirmations
2075
spent
true